Dexter Season 7 – New Promos Suggest Deb Needs to Die

The big hot-button question going into Dexter Season 7 is just what will happen to the brother/sister relationship between Dexter and Deb now that she has caught her brother red handed – literally. In the Season 6 finale, Deb walked in on Dexter just as he murdered the Doomsday Killer, effectively showing his true colors as a serial killer, or as the new promotional videos tell it, his exposing his Dark Passenger. So what happens next? Where do you go after finding out your brother is a serial killer? Naturally Dexter will have some explaining to do, and it’s unlikely he’ll be able to lie his way out of this situation.

There are a lot of variables that will come into play. They’ve been siblings – though Dexter was adopted – for most of their lives, and Deb has recently discovered she is in love with Dexter. But she’s also Lieutenant of Miami Metro, so she has an obligation to do something about Dexter. Yet as the first promo below mentions, Dexter isn’t concerned with what Deb will do, but with what he will do. If his true nature stands to be exposed to the world, will he do whatever he can to keep him and his son safe, including murdering his own sister? Could that be what this promo is implying?
The second promo adds to this speculation. It’s mostly the same as the first, but ends with Dexter claiming he never had a choice with living with his secret, but Deb does. Is he saying she has a choice whether or not to keep it a secret, or to live? The wording leaves it open for interpretation; giving further traction to the idea Dexter might consider murdering Deb to guarantee her silence. It’s an interesting way to look at the situation, but I hope it doesn’t have to come to that. Deb is good character and would be more valuable alive than dead.
